What Makes a No-KYC Virtual Card Different
Standard debit or credit cards tie your spending to a verified identity, credit history, and residential proof. A no-KYC alternative decouples the card from those requirements. The trade-off is usually a spending cap and a focus on online purchases only—ideal for Netflix, Spotify, or SaaS tools.
- Instant issuance: Receive card details by email or dashboard within seconds
- Privacy-first: No passport, utility bill, or selfie upload required
- Prepaid control: Load only what you plan to spend on streaming
- Global acceptance: Works wherever Visa or Mastercard is processed online
